Residencial Las Palmeras II
Residencial Las Palmeras II is a neighborhood in Orihuela, Alicante, Valencian Community. Residencial Las Palmeras II is situated nearby to the neighborhood Urbanización Al Andalus II, as well as near Residencial Villas del Duque.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Torrevieja
Photo: baloun,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Torrevieja is a coastal town and center of tourism in the south of Alicante province in Costa Blanca, Spain. It is situated within the district of Vega Baja and has a population of 90,000 inhabitants.
